The Celestron Nexstar 6SE is a portable, easy-to-set-up Schmidt-Cassegrain telescope featuring a 150mm aperture and f/10 optics. Equipped with NEXSTAR+ hand control, it locates over 40,000 celestial objects. The SkyAlign system enables quick alignment, while the SkyPortal Wi-Fi kit with Sky Link 2 offers seamless access to audio-guided astronomy content, making it ideal for millennial professionals seeking a smart, immersive stargazing experience.

Tried and true
I owned this scope in the past about 17 years ago. I was amazed by this scope. I have owed bigger and better scopes like 8 and 9.25 by this company. I like this one better because of its light weight. If you grab a smaller scope more often then the bigger heavier one then buy the lighter cause you’ll use it more often. There is so many options in this scope now vs back in the day and I’m glad to own another one. I found this to be pretty easy to set up align and use. But with the starsense technology I’m sure it’s way easier now. I’m working on mounting a guide scope for this as my plans are astrophotography. The pics I have included with this was on a range of 6se, 8se, and cpx 9.25 and the views you see will be close to this and or astrophotography with a cannon rebel and celestron neximager.
